Publisher's Synopsis

Dalia Magaña's Building Confianza demonstrates that effective doctor-patient communication in Spanish requires that practitioners not only have knowledge of Spanish but also have transcultural knowledge of Latino/a values and language use. Using linguistic analysis to study real-time doctor-patient interactions, Magaña probes the role of interpersonal language and transcultural competency in improving patient-centered health care with Spanish-speaking Latino/as, highlighting successful examples of how Latino/a cultural constructs of confianza (trust), familismo (family-orientation), personalismo (friendliness), respeto (respect), and simpatìa (kindness) can be deployed in medical interactions. She proposes that transcultural interactions entail knowing patients' cultural values and being mindful about creating an interpersonal connection with patients through small talk, humor, self-disclosure, politeness, and informal language, including language switching and culturally appropriate use of colloquialisms. By explicitly articulating discourse strategies doctors can use in communicating with Spanish-speaking patients, Building Confianza will aid both students and providers in connecting to communities of Spanish speakers in health care contexts and advancing transcultural competence.
